Free Plan
Designed for small teams or those looking to explore the platform, the Free plan supports up to 5 users and 10 courses, with no time limits or setup fees.
Core Plan
Starting at $109 per month, the Core plan accommodates up to 100 users and includes essential LMS features suitable for small to medium-sized organizations.
Grow Plan
Priced at $229 per month, the Grow plan supports up to 500 users, offering additional capabilities tailored for expanding teams.
Pro Plan
At $399 per month, the Pro plan is designed for larger organizations, supporting up to 1,000 users, with options for flexible user limits beyond that.
Enterprise Plan
For organizations requiring over 1,000 users or custom solutions, the Enterprise plan offers tailored features and pricing based on specific needs.
